Information about Matroska

Matroska (Матрёшка)
File extension:.mkv .mka
MIME type:video/x-matroska audio/x-matroska
Developed by:Matroska.org
Type of format:Container format
Container for:Multimedia


The Matroska Multimedia Container is an open standard free Container format, a file format that can hold an unlimited number of video, audio, picture or subtitle tracks inside a single file.[1] It is intended to serve as a universal format for storing common multimedia content, like movies or TV shows. Matroska is similar in conception to other containers like AVI, MP4 or ASF, but is completely open source. Matroska file types are .MKV for video (and audio) and .MKA for audio-only files.

Matroska is an English word derived from the Russian word Матрёшка (transliterated as Matryoshka). Which is pronounced as: mat + ros (as in albatross OR as in metros) + ka (as in Alaska). Simply stated, the term Matroska means 'nesting doll' (the common eastern European egg shaped doll within a doll). This is a play on the container (media within a form of media/Doll Within a Doll) aspect of the Matryoshka as it is a container for visual and audio data.

History

The project was announced on December 7 2002 as a fork of an earlier container format project, but after disagreements with that project's creator about the use of the Extensible Binary Meta Language (EBML) instead of another binary format. The founders of the Matroska project believe that the use of EBML brings them a number of advantages, including making it easier to extend the format for decades into the future as new developments occur and or as the project goals change.

Goals

With Matroska's roots in EBML it has been designed from the ground up for longevity and extendability (unlike formats such as AVI). The Matroska team has spoken openly on Doom9.org and hydrogenaudio.org about some of their long term goals to create a modern, flexible, extensible, cross-platform multimedia container format that can:
  • develop robust streaming support.
  • develop a 'DVD-like' menu system based on EBML.
  • develop a set of tools for the creation and editing of Matroska files.
  • develop libraries that can be used to allow developers to add Matroska support to their applications.
  • work with hardware manufacturers to include Matroska support in embedded multimedia devices.
  • provide native Matroska support in various operating systems.

Software support

Listed below is software that has native Matroska support. For Windows also DirectShow filters like Haali Media Splitter can be used which allow playback of Matroska files in all DirectShow based players.

For Mac OS X users, Perian can allow playback in QuickTime Player.

License

Matroska is an open standards project. This means for personal use it is absolutely free to use and that the technical specifications describing the bit stream are open to everybody, even to companies that would like to support it in their products. The source code of the libraries developed by the Matroska Development Team is licensed under GNU LGPL. In addition to that, there are also free parsing and playback libraries available under the BSD license, for proprietary software adaption.

See also

References

External links

A filename extension is a suffix to the name of a computer file applied to indicate its type. It is commonly used to infer information about what sort of data might be stored in the file.
..... Click the link for more information.
Mime or pantomime is a theatrical medium or performance art, involving the acting out of a story by a mime artist through body motions, without use of speech.

History


..... Click the link for more information.


A container format is a computer file format that can contain various types of data, compressed by means of standardized audio/video codecs.
..... Click the link for more information.
Multimedia (Lat. Multum + Medium) is media that uses multiple forms of information content and information processing (e.g. text, audio, graphics, animation, video, interactivity) to inform or entertain the (user) audience.
..... Click the link for more information.
An open standard is a standard that is publicly available and has various rights to use associated with it.

The terms "open" and "standard" have a wide range of meanings associated with their usage.
..... Click the link for more information.
A free file format is a file format that is free of any patents or copyright. They should have a freely available specification. Free file formats are good for interoperability and to prevent vendor lock-in. It is a cornerstone in open systems.
..... Click the link for more information.


A container format is a computer file format that can contain various types of data, compressed by means of standardized audio/video codecs.
..... Click the link for more information.
A file format is a particular way to encode information for storage in a computer file.

Since a disk drive, or indeed any computer storage, can store only bits, the computer must have some way of converting information to 0s and 1s and vice-versa.
..... Click the link for more information.
Audio Video Interleave

File extension: .avi
MIME type: video/avi
video/msvideo
video/x-msvideo

Type code: 'Vfw '
Uniform Type Identifier: public.
..... Click the link for more information.
MP4 (MPEG-4 Part 14)

File extension: .mp4
MIME type: video/mp4
Type code: mpg4
Developed by: ISO
Type of format: Media container
Container for: Audio, video, text
Extended from: Quicktime .
..... Click the link for more information.
Advanced Systems Format

File extension: .asf
MIME type: video/x-ms-asf
Type code: 'ASF_'
Uniform Type Identifier: com.microsoft.advanced-​systems-format
Magic: 30 26 b2 75
Developed by: Microsoft
..... Click the link for more information.
Open source is a set of principles and practices that promote access to the design and production of goods and knowledge. The term is most commonly applied to the source code of software that is available to the general public with relaxed or non-existent intellectual property
..... Click the link for more information.
matryoshka doll (Russian: матрёшка, IPA: [mʌˈtrʲoʂkə]) or a Russian nested doll (also called a
..... Click the link for more information.
matryoshka doll (Russian: матрёшка, IPA: [mʌˈtrʲoʂkə]) or a Russian nested doll (also called a
..... Click the link for more information.
December 7 is the 1st day of the year (2nd in leap years) in the Gregorian calendar. There are 0 days remaining.

Events

  • 1724 - Toruń Blood tribunal (German:

..... Click the link for more information.
20th century - 21st century - 22nd century
1970s  1980s  1990s  - 2000s -  2010s  2020s  2030s
1999 2000 2001 - 2002 - 2003 2004 2005

2002 by topic:
News by month
Jan - Feb - Mar - Apr - May - Jun
..... Click the link for more information.
In software engineering, a project fork happens when developers take a copy of source code from one software package and start independent development on it, creating a distinct piece of software.
..... Click the link for more information.
Extensible Binary Meta Language

File extension: none
Magic: 1a 45 df a3
Extended to: Matroska Extensible Binary Meta Language (EBML) is a generalized file format for any kind of data, aiming to be a binary equivalent to XML.
..... Click the link for more information.
An operating system (OS) is the software that manages the sharing of the resources of a computer. An operating system processes system data and user input, and responds by allocating and managing tasks and internal system resources as a service to users and programs of the
..... Click the link for more information.
This article or section is written like an .
Please help [ rewrite this article] from a neutral point of view.
Mark blatant advertising for , using .

BS.Player

BS.Player 2.
..... Click the link for more information.
Maintainer: Gretech Corporation

OS: Win 98se/ME/2K/XP/Vista

Use: Media player
License: Freeware
Website: GOM Player

GOM Player (Gretech Online Movie Player
..... Click the link for more information.
HandBrake is free open source, GPL licensed, multithreaded, cross-platform software that can decrypt and convert a DVD into a MPEG-4 video file in .mp4, .avi, .ogm, or .mkv containers. Originally developed for BeOS, it is now available for Mac OS X, Linux, and Windows.
..... Click the link for more information.
This article or section is written like an .
Please help [ rewrite this article] from a neutral point of view.
Mark blatant advertising for , using .
jetAudio

Maintainer: Cowon America

OS: Windows

Use:
..... Click the link for more information.
Media Player Classic (MPC) is a compact free software media player for Microsoft Windows. The application mimics the look and feel of the old, light-weight Windows Media Player 6.
..... Click the link for more information.
mplayer2.exe, see the Windows Media Player article. For the online gaming community, see MPlayer.com.


MPlayer

MPlayer screenshot
Maintainer: MPlayer team

OS: Cross-platform

Use: Media player
License: GPL

..... Click the link for more information.
Maintainer: CyberLink

OS: Windows

Use: Video Player
License: Proprietary
Website: www.cyberlink.com

PowerDVD (from CyberLink) is a commercial video player and music player for Microsoft Windows.
..... Click the link for more information.
Maintainer: CoreCodec, Inc.

OS: Windows

Use: Media player
License: Closed Source
Website: http://www.tcmp.org/

The Core Media Player (TCMP) is a DirectShow-based media player for Windows only.
..... Click the link for more information.
Maintainer: CoreCodec, Inc.

OS: Cross-platform

Use: Media player
License: Open Source/Proprietary
Website: http://tcpmp.corecodec.org/ The Core Pocket Media Player (TCPMP) is a software media player.
..... Click the link for more information.
Maintainer: Kang, YoungHuee

OS: Windows

Use: Media player
License: Freeware
Website: www.kmplayer.com


..... Click the link for more information.
Maintainer: Totem Team

OS: Unix-like

Use: Media player
License: GNU General Public License
Website: www.gnome.org/projects/totem/

Totem
..... Click the link for more information.


This article is copied from an article on Wikipedia.org - the free encyclopedia created and edited by online user community. The text was not checked or edited by anyone on our staff. Although the vast majority of the wikipedia encyclopedia articles provide accurate and timely information please do not assume the accuracy of any particular article. This article is distributed under the terms of GNU Free Documentation License.
Herod_Archelaus


page counter